Overview of the Learjet 25
Introduced in the mid-1960s, the Learjet 25 is a light business jet developed by Learjet, a company founded by aviation pioneer William P. Lear. It is an evolution of the earlier Learjet 24, offering improved payload capacity and extended range.
Designed primarily for corporate travel and military applications, the Learjet 25 quickly gained popularity due to its ability to combine speed, altitude performance, and operational efficiency.
Key Specifications of Learjet 25
Here are the core technical specifications that define the Learjet 25:
Crew: 2 (pilot and co-pilot)
Passenger Capacity: Up to 8 passengers
Length: 47 ft 7 in (14.5 m)
Wingspan: 35 ft 7 in (10.8 m)
Height: 12 ft 3 in (3.7 m)
Maximum Speed: ~561 mph (903 km/h)
Cruise Speed: ~535 mph (861 km/h)
Range: Approximately 2,000 miles (3,200 km)
Service Ceiling: 45,000 feet
These specifications made the Learjet 25 one of the fastest business jets of its era.
Performance and Capabilities
One of the standout features of the Learjet 25 is its exceptional climb rate and high-altitude performance. It can climb rapidly to cruising altitude, allowing it to avoid commercial air traffic and turbulent weather.
lSpeed and Efficiency
The Learjet 25 was designed for speed. Even by today’s standards, its cruise speed remains competitive in the light jet category. This made it a favorite for executives needing quick, efficient travel between cities.
High Altitude Advantage
Flying at up to 45,000 feet, the aircraft operates above most weather systems, ensuring smoother flights and improved fuel efficiency.
Cabin Comfort and Interior
While the Learjet 25 prioritizes performance, it also offers a comfortable cabin environment:
Club-style seating arrangements
Compact galley for light refreshments
Enclosed lavatory (in most configurations)
Pressurized cabin for high-altitude comfort
Though not as spacious as modern jets, the Learjet 25 provides a functional and comfortable experience for short to medium-haul flights.

Operational Uses
The Learjet 25 has been used in a variety of roles beyond corporate travel:
Military training aircraft
Medical evacuation (air ambulance)
Aerial reconnaissance
Cargo transport (light freight)
Its versatility and reliability made it a valuable asset across industries.

Limitations to Consider
Despite its strengths, the Learjet 25 does have some drawbacks:
Limited cabin space compared to modern jets
Higher fuel consumption than newer models
Older avionics unless upgraded
Noise levels higher than contemporary aircraft
Learjet 25 in Today’s Market
Although production has long ceased, the Learjet 25 remains active in niche markets. Many aircraft have been refurbished with modern avionics, making them viable for specialized operations such as air ambulance services.
However, due to stricter aviation regulations and fuel efficiency standards, its use in mainstream corporate aviation has declined.
